Prestigious Universities and Landmarks
On this private Oxford day trip from London, visitors are treated to an in-depth exploration of the city’s prestigious universities and iconic landmarks.
The tour includes skip-the-line entry to three must-see locations:
-
Christ Church College, one of Oxford’s largest and most famous colleges, known for its grand architecture and literary connections.
-
Sheldonian Theatre, the official ceremonial hall of the University of Oxford, designed by renowned architect Christopher Wren.
-
University Church of St Mary, a stunning 13th-century church with a tower that offers panoramic views of the city’s picturesque skyline.
These prestigious sites provide a glimpse into Oxford’s rich academic and cultural heritage.
